- The Lincolnshire coroner ruled that Michael Reynolds died from a hypoxic cardiac arrest caused by epiglottitis and identified a missed opportunity for urgent hospital referral.
- GPs initially treated his severe throat swelling and inability to swallow as tonsillitis, prescribing antibiotics without advising emergency department assessment.
- After collecting medication, Reynolds collapsed at home, suffered a seizure, and died in hospital on December 1, 2023.
- His family has hired medical negligence solicitors Irwin Mitchell to investigate the decision not to refer him for resuscitation-level care.
- They are calling for enhanced primary-care triage protocols and greater awareness of epiglottitis among frontline clinicians.
